Conversion Formula for Gigawatt Hour to Microjoule
The formula of conversion of Gigawatt Hour to Microjoule is very simple. To convert Gigawatt Hour to Microjoule, we can use this simple formula:
1 Gigawatt Hour = 3,600,000,000,000,000,000 Microjoule
1 Microjoule = 0 Gigawatt Hour
One Gigawatt Hour is equal to 3,600,000,000,000,000,000 Microjoule. So, we need to multiply the number of Gigawatt Hour by 3,600,000,000,000,000,000 to get the no of Microjoule. This formula helps when we need to change the measurements from Gigawatt Hour to Microjoule

Details for Gigawatt-Hour (Grid-Level Energy Scale)
Introduction : The gigawatt-hour equals one billion watt-hours and is suited for representing vast quantities of electrical energy—typically at the scale of national grids, large industrial zones, or global reporting.
History & Origin : With the expansion of global energy infrastructure, the GWh became essential for international comparisons, grid reports, and cumulative production tracking over long durations.
Current Use : Used in national energy statistics, grid-scale reporting, and strategic energy planning. Appears in reports on renewable energy contributions, nuclear plant outputs, and global energy balances.
Details for Microjoule (Microscale Energy)
Introduction : One microjoule equals one-millionth of a joule and is used for extremely small-scale energy measurements, including semiconductor technology, nanotechnology, and microelectromechanical systems (MEMS).
History & Origin : Became important with the development of low-energy electronics and precision instruments. The microjoule allows scientists to express energy consumption at the tiniest operational levels.
Current Use : Critical in electronics, where circuits operate with minuscule energy, and in nanotech research. Useful for evaluating low-power computing devices, energy harvesting systems, and sensor design.
